Weather in June

The first month of the summer, June, is a warm month in Abiquiu, New Mexico, with an average temperature ranging between max 81.3°F (27.4°C) and min 52.3°F (11.3°C).

Temperature

Observing a rise in June, the average high-temperature goes from May's agreeable 69.1°F (20.6°C) to a moderately hot 81.3°F (27.4°C). A sharp divergence from daytime highs is noted during the month of June, with the average nighttime temperature settling at a fresh 52.3°F (11.3°C).

Humidity

With an average relative humidity of 32%, June is the least humid month in Abiquiu.

Rainfall

In Abiquiu, during June, the rain falls for 8 days and regularly aggregates up to 0.63" (16mm) of precipitation. Throughout the year, in Abiquiu, there are 89.9 rainfall days, and 7.76" (197m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

In Abiquiu, snow does not fall in June through September.

Daylight

The month with the longest days in Abiquiu is June, with an average of 14h and 36min of daylight.
On the first day of June in Abiquiu, sunrise is at 5:48 am and sunset at 8:17 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:51 am and sunset at 8:26 pm MDT.

Sunshine

With an average of 12.1h of sunshine, June has the most sunshine of the year in Abiquiu.

UV index

June and July,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the highest UV index in Abiquiu.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the average person.
